Several common situations lead to the formation of rust stains on canvas fabric.
Direct metal contact is a frequent cause of rust stains. Metal components often found on canvas items, such as buckles, grommets, snaps, zippers, or even tools inadvertently left resting on the fabric surface, can oxidize and transfer rust to the canvas.
Iron particles present in certain water sources constitute another cause. Water from some sprinkler systems or outdoor runoff may contain dissolved iron. When this iron-rich water comes into contact with canvas and then evaporates, the iron deposits can oxidize, resulting in rust stains.
Transfer from other rusty surfaces is also a pathway. If canvas touches an already rusted object, rust particles can migrate to the fabric.
High humidity environments significantly accelerate the oxidation (rusting) process of metals. Metals located near or in contact with canvas material in such humid conditions are more prone to rusting, thereby increasing the risk of rust stain formation on the canvas.

Cotton canvas, which includes widely used varieties like cotton duck canvas, is a natural fiber material. Cotton canvas is known for its general robustness. It can, however, be sensitive to overly harsh chemical treatments or excessive physical abrasion during the rust removal process. The colorfastness of dyed cotton canvas also varies considerably. This variability makes meticulous spot testing absolutely necessary before applying any cleaning solution to the main stained area of colored cotton canvas. Synthetic canvas fabrics, such as those constructed from polyester or acrylic fibers, often show greater resistance to certain chemicals when compared to natural cotton canvas. Synthetic canvas is also typically less absorbent. However, some strong solvents or exposure to high heat can cause damage to these synthetic materials. Understanding the specific properties of synthetic canvas fabrics like polyester or nylon assists in selecting a safe and effective rust removal method. The color of the canvas is a highly important factor in rust stain removal. Colored canvas fabric presents a notably higher risk of discoloration, bleeding, or fading when treated with rust removal agents, particularly acidic solutions or stronger commercial products. White canvas, while not susceptible to dye loss, can sometimes yellow if certain improper chemical cleaning agents are used, or if chemical residues are not thoroughly rinsed from the fabric after treatment.
If your canvas item has special finishes—for example, treatments for waterproofing, flame retardancy, or UV resistance—it is important to recognize that rust removal agents might affect or even strip these protective canvas fabric treatments. Knowing how cleaning attempts might affect any existing canvas fabric treatments is a necessary consideration before you begin the rust removal process.
No, not all rust stains on canvas are identical. Their characteristics vary. Their ease of removal also varies. Fresh rust stains—those that have formed recently—are generally less challenging to remove compared to older, more established rust stains. Old or set-in rust stains have had a longer period for the iron oxide particles to penetrate deeply into the canvas fibers and form stronger bonds with the material. These more stubborn rust stains often require more potent cleaning solutions or multiple treatment applications to achieve satisfactory rust removal.
A distinction also exists between surface rust stains and those that are deeply penetrated into the weave of the canvas. Surface rust stains might respond well to gentler rust removal methods. Deeply penetrated rust stains, conversely, will likely necessitate a more thorough and persistent approach to effectively lift the iron oxide from the canvas fabric.

The combination of lemon juice and salt is a widely utilized and often successful DIY method for removing rust stains from canvas fabric. This particular technique is popular due to its simplicity, reliance on readily available household items, and its generally good safety profile on many canvas types when applied with care.
The effectiveness of lemon juice in rust removal originates from its natural citric acid content. Citric acid is a mild organic acid. This acid reacts chemically with iron oxide (the chemical compound that forms rust), helping to loosen its bond with the canvas fibers and dissolve it. Salt (sodium chloride) acts primarily as a gentle abrasive when this mixture is applied to the rust stain. The fine crystals of salt help to physically scrub away the loosened rust particles from the canvas surface without being overly harsh on most durable canvas materials. Additionally, salt can play a role in drawing the dissolved rust stain and moisture out of the fabric through an osmotic effect.

White vinegar is another common and effective household item for treating rust stains on canvas fabric. Its primary active component responsible for its rust-removing capability is acetic acid.
Acetic acid, typically present in white distilled vinegar at a concentration of around 5%, is a mild acid. This acid effectively works to dissolve iron oxide, which is the chemical compound that constitutes rust. The chemical reaction between acetic acid and iron oxide helps to break down the structure of the rust stain. This breakdown makes the rust easier to lift and remove from the fibers of the canvas fabric.

Baking soda (sodium bicarbonate) can be utilized as a mild cleaning agent and gentle abrasive for some lighter rust stains on canvas fabric. Its effectiveness against rust when used as a standalone agent is often more limited compared to acidic solutions like lemon juice or vinegar. However, baking soda can be a useful component of a broader rust removal strategy or for very delicate canvas where stronger agents are undesirable.
Baking soda primarily works by providing a fine, gentle scouring action when it is made into a paste with water. This mild abrasive quality can help to physically lift some surface-level rust stains or loosen very light rust particles from the canvas. It is less about chemically dissolving the core structure of the rust and more about physically dislodging it. Baking soda is also slightly alkaline, a property which can aid in certain cleaning applications by neutralizing acidic residues or breaking down some types of soil.

Beyond the commonly used lemon juice, white vinegar, and baking soda, a few other natural substances are occasionally mentioned in home remedies for rust stain removal. Their application to canvas fabric, however, requires the same degree of caution, thorough spot testing, and understanding of their properties as any other cleaning agent.
Cream of tartar (potassium bitartrate) is one such substance. Cream of tartar is a mild acid. For the purpose of rust removal, cream of tartar is typically prepared by making it into a paste. This paste is often created by mixing cream of tartar with a few drops of lemon juice or, sometimes, hydrogen peroxide, which can enhance its cleaning action. This paste is then applied directly to the rust stain on the canvas, allowed to sit for a specific period, and subsequently rinsed off thoroughly. The acidity of cream of tartar is the primary mechanism by which it acts against rust stains.
Another traditional remedy, though less commonly cited specifically for canvas fabric, involves the use of a potato and salt. A cut raw potato contains small amounts of oxalic acid. Oxalic acid is a chemical compound known for its effectiveness as a rust-removing agent (it is a key ingredient in many commercial rust removers). The method generally involves slicing a potato, dipping the freshly cut end into table salt (the salt acts as a gentle abrasive in this application), and then rubbing this salted potato surface directly over the rust stain. After this application and some contact time, the area is rinsed. The concentration of oxalic acid in potatoes is relatively low. This method is generally more suited for very light, fresh rust stains and may not be effective on more significant or older rust marks. Given the mechanical rubbing action and the moisture introduced from the potato, its use on canvas fabric would require extremely careful application and diligent spot testing to avoid damaging the material or spreading the stain.

Users need to exercise significant caution with certain chemical ingredients when selecting or using any cleaning agents on canvas fabric, particularly for the purpose of rust stain removal.
Chlorine bleach (sodium hypochlorite) must never be used in an attempt to remove rust stains from any type of canvas. This is a critical point. Chlorine bleach can undergo a chemical reaction with iron oxide (the rust itself), which often results in making the rust stain darker, more deeply set into the fabric, and effectively permanent and impossible to remove. Additionally, chlorine bleach is an aggressive chemical that can severely damage and weaken cotton canvas fibers. It can also cause unsightly yellowing on white or natural-colored canvas and will almost certainly strip or alter the color from dyed canvas fabrics.
Overly strong acids, if they are not properly diluted according to manufacturer instructions for safe fabric use, or if they are not rinsed out completely and promptly from the canvas material after treatment, can also lead to progressive fiber degradation and weakening over time. This is a primary reason why meticulously following recommended dwell times and ensuring extremely thorough rinsing procedures are so important when dealing with any acidic rust remover, whether it is a DIY solution or a commercial product.

Removing rust stains from canvas shoes, such as popular footwear styles from brands like Converse or Vans, involves applying the same basic rust removal principles discussed earlier. However, some special techniques and considerations are needed due_ to the shoe’s specific construction and multiple materials.
Before applying any rust removal solution, protect non-canvas parts of the shoe if possible. Rubber soles, plastic or metal eyelets (unless the eyelets themselves are the source of the rust stain), and laces can sometimes be carefully masked off using painter’s tape. Alternatively, apply the cleaning solution very precisely to avoid these areas.
Use a small brush, like an old toothbrush or a cotton swab, for precise application of the chosen rust removal solution directly onto the stained canvas areas of the shoe. This precise control helps prevent the cleaner from spreading unnecessarily to other parts of the shoe or onto unstained canvas.
Thorough rinsing after treatment is particularly important for canvas shoes. Complete removal of all cleaning agent residues is necessary to avoid potential skin irritation for the wearer or any adverse effects on the appearance and feel of the shoe’s interior lining. Rinse under a gentle stream of cool water.
After the rust removal treatment and thorough rinsing, allow the canvas shoes to air dry completely. Place them in a well-ventilated area away from direct heat sources like radiators, heaters, or clothes dryers. Such direct heat could potentially warp the shoe’s shape, damage adhesives, or shrink the canvas material. Stuffing the shoes loosely with plain white paper towels during the drying process can help absorb internal moisture and assist in maintaining their shape.
Treating rust stains on large canvas items—such as extensive outdoor awnings, family-sized tents, or substantial boat covers—often makes it impractical or impossible to immerse the item for cleaning. This usually necessitates cleaning these items in place.
When cleaning in place, ensure an even application of your chosen rust removal solution over the entire stained area. For large vertical canvas surfaces, like an installed awning, this might involve working in manageable, systematic sections, often from the bottom upwards. Working upwards can help prevent clean streaks from forming due to runoff of the cleaning solution over soiled lower areas.
Thorough and complete rinsing over these large surface areas is absolutely critical. A garden hose equipped with a gentle spray nozzle is frequently the most practical tool for effectively rinsing items like canvas awnings or boat covers. Ensure that all cleaner residue is meticulously flushed away from every part of the treated canvas.
Managing the runoff of cleaning solutions, especially when using chemical rust removers, is an important environmental consideration. If possible, try to direct the runoff away from sensitive garden plants, lawns, or direct entry into storm drains. Using absorbent materials like old towels or booms at the base of the cleaning area can sometimes help catch and contain the runoff.
The tools used for cleaning these larger canvas items might need to be scaled up appropriately. For example, a soft-bristled deck brush with a long handle could be suitable for gently applying the rust removal solution to a large canvas awning surface.
Allowing these large canvas items to dry completely and thoroughly before they are stored, folded, rolled, or retracted (in the case of awnings) is essential. Trapped moisture in large folds of damp canvas can quickly lead to mildew growth, which introduces new stains and can damage the fabric. Good air circulation all around the canvas is key for effective drying. Thorough rinsing after rust stain treatment on canvas serves several important functions for the health and longevity of the fabric.
It prevents any remaining chemical residues from the cleaning agent (whether it was a DIY solution like vinegar or a commercial rust remover) from continuing to act upon the canvas fibers. If left in place, these residues could lead to gradual weakening, degradation, or discoloration of the material over extended periods.
Rinsing removes all loosened rust particles along with the cleaning solution components. If not removed, these residues might dry on the fabric, leaving it feeling stiff, potentially attracting new dirt, or even causing a secondary, different type of stain.
It effectively stops the chemical action of the rust remover, ensuring that the cleaning process is properly concluded and that no further unintended chemical reactions occur within the canvas fabric.
The best method for rinsing canvas after rust removal involves using an ample supply of cool, clean water.
If the canvas item being treated is of a manageable size (e.g., a bag, a cushion cover, a small mat), try to flush the treated area from the reverse side of the rust stain whenever this is practical. This rinsing technique helps to push the dissolved rust particles and the cleaning solution residues out of the fabric structure, rather than potentially driving them further into the weave of the canvas.
Continue the rinsing process until there is absolutely no longer any trace of the cleaning agent perceptible on the canvas. This means no visible suds (if the cleaner was one that produced suds), no lingering odor from the solution (such as the smell of vinegar), and the rinse water running off the canvas should be completely clear.
For rinsing larger canvas items like awnings, tents, or boat covers, a garden hose equipped with a gentle spray nozzle can be used effectively. Ensure that the water pressure from the hose is not excessively high. A very strong jet of water could potentially damage the canvas fabric, especially if it is an older or more delicate material.

While canvas fabric itself, being a textile, cannot be made inherently “rust-proof” (as rust is a corrosion process specific to iron-containing metals), certain treatments applied to the canvas or modifications to the overall canvas system (which includes the fabric and any associated hardware) can make it significantly more resistant to the conditions that typically lead to the formation of rust stains.
Many commercially available fabric protector sprays are designed to offer robust water repellency. Silicone-based sprays, fluoropolymer-based protectors (similar to those used in products like Scotchgard™), and specialized marine-grade fabric treatments can create an effective hydrophobic (water-repelling) barrier on the surface of the canvas. This barrier causes water droplets to bead up and roll off the fabric, rather than soaking into the fibers. By reducing water absorption, these treatments help keep the canvas drier, which in turn minimizes the contact time between moisture and any metal components, thereby reducing the likelihood of rust formation and transfer.

While it is physically possible to apply paint over a rust stain on some types of heavy-duty utility canvas (for example, a rugged tarpaulin where aesthetic appearance is secondary and the canvas remains structurally sound), this is generally not a recommended solution for most common canvas items such as clothing, bags, upholstery, tents, or artistic canvas. The primary issue is that the rust stain can often bleed through layers of paint over time, eventually reappearing on the painted surface. Additionally, applying a layer of paint will significantly alter the canvas fabric’s natural texture, its flexibility, and its breathability, which can be undesirable for many applications. Effective stain removal should always be the preferred first approach before considering painting over a rust stain.
